jxProject is an open-source platform for building and managing Java/Jakarta EE applications. It provides a project structure, build automation, dependency management, and utilities to help developers quickly scaffold, develop, test, and deploy applications.

Kanboard is an open-source project management software that helps teams organize tasks and projects. It provides Kanban boards, task management, calendars and time tracking features in a simple visual interface.
